概述
TP(TokenPocket)等多链钱包中,代币头像并非链上强制字段,而是由客户端通过多种渠道获取并渲染。头像不仅影响用户识别与支付效率,也与安全、隐私和合规直接相关。下面从六个维度综合分析实现方式、优化路径与风险控制建议。
1. 高效支付技术
- 来源整合:优先使用本地缓存+CDN分发的图标包(svg/webp),对热门代币预置图标,降低首次渲染延迟。对非预置代币采用Token List(如Uniswap格式)、Trust Wallet Assets、CoinGecko等聚合源。
- 性能优化:懒加载、占位图、合并请求、HTTP/2或HTTP/3、图片格式优化和尺寸约束,保证在资产切换及小额快速支付场景下图标即时可见,减少误操作概率。
2. 前瞻性技术发展
- 去中心化元数据:结合IPFS/Arweave存储图标并在合约或域名记录中保存content-hash,逐步迁移到基于DID/可验证凭证的资产标识体系,使图标来源可证明、可溯源。
- NFT与ENS集成:支持ENS/域名头像解析、ERC-721/1155头像以及未来链上头像标准,让持有者对头像拥有更多控制权。
3. 市场趋势报告
- 社区与托管并行:主流路线为社区维护的图标仓库(如GitHub仓库)与第三方数据商(CoinGecko/CMC/交易所)并行,社区仓库便于响应新币,数据商提供价格与信任背书。
- 趋势:向多链统一资产规范、跨钱包Token List标准化、以及更严格的验证机制演进。
4. 全球科技模式
- 中央化+去中心化混合模式最常见:客户端优先使用经过审计与签名的白名单(中心化)并支持从去中心化存储回退,保障可用性与抗审查性。
- 跨地域CDN、多云备份与合规节点部署,降低网络与审查风险,提升全球用户体验。
5. 实时数据保护
- 隐私保护:避免直接从第三方域名按钱包地址或资产查询时泄露用户持仓,采用代理或聚合层统一请求、并对外部图标请求做匿名化处理。
- 安全校验:所有外部图标通过HTTPS、证书校验、content-hash比对或签名验证;对SVG执行净化(去除脚本、外链),防止XSS/CSRF类攻击。
6. 系统审计
- 审计要点:图标仓库的提交审计、CI/CD自动化扫描、签名/哈希验证流程、第三方数据源入链前的风控规则。定期渗透测试、依赖项供应链审查与变更日志透明化。
实践建议(要点清单)

- 优先显示本地或可信源预置图标,未知代币显示默认占位并提供“请求图标/上传图标”流程;
- 对所有外部图标实施哈希白名单或签名验证;

- 使用IPFS/Arweave作为去中心化回退存储,并在元数据中记录content-hash;
- 采用代理请求或缓存策略保护用户隐私,禁止客户端直接泄露敏感请求参数;
- 建立图标变更告警、审计日志与人工复核机制,定期第三方安全评估。
结论
代币头像看似UI细节,实则涉及支付效率、用户安全与信任链。最佳实践是采用中心化可信源与去中心化回退的混合架构,配合严格的实时验证与审计机制,以及性能优化策略,从而在全球多链、多场景下既保证可用性,又最大化安全与可溯源性。
评论
Crypto小白
讲得很全面,尤其是隐私和SVG净化那部分,值得借鉴。
Alex_W
希望未来能看到TP原生支持ENS头像和IPFS回退,文章提到的方向很实用。
链上观察者
关于图标签名验证,能否分享常见实现方案或现成库?很期待后续实操指南。
Mia张
不错,兼顾了用户体验和安全,尤其赞同本地预置与白名单策略。